
What is Environmental Engineering
Saving the environment is one of the most crucial mottos of the 21st century, with an increasing imbalance between humans and nature, many initiatives are taken at an academic level. Courses like Environmental Engineering are introduced globally for sustainable development and consumption of resources.
The Environmental Engineering course is a branch of engineering that focuses on the issues related to the environment. The course encourages students to find scientific solutions for environmental problems like automobile pollution and finding renewable energy sources.
The course is available in most engineering institutes across India and abroad. The course is multi-disciplinary and combines the knowledge of subjects like soil science, physics, chemistry, engineering, and biology.
The Environmental Engineering course focuses on designing policies and regulating the development of technologies for managing contaminated lands and ensuring the safety of people along with environmental elements.

Career Opportunities in Environmental Engineering
- Agricultural Engineers
An agricultural engineer makes farming sustainable, safe, and environmentally friendly. They analyze agricultural operations and weigh the use of new technologies and methods to increase yields, improve land use, and conserve resources like seed, water, fertilizers, pesticides and fuel.
- Biologists
Biologists study biotic forms like plants and animals and the world they live in. It is a good field for people interested in the natural world and who enjoy practical science.
- Chemical Engineers
Chemical Engineers work principally in the chemical industry to convert basic raw materials into a variety of products.
- Analytical Chemists
Analytical chemists use a diverse range of methods to investigate the chemical nature of substances. The aim of such work is to identify and understand substances and how they behave in different conditions.
- Recycling Plants
Environmental Engineers develop technologies to recycle waste material and ensure their proper utilization.
- Ecologists
Ecologists are concerned with ecosystems as a whole, the abundance and distribution of organisms (people, plants, animals), and the relationships between organisms and their environment.
- Legal Consultants
Environmental Engineers often work as advisors to legal firms dealing with issues and companies involved in environmental degradation.
- Conservationist
Environmental Engineers work towards innovating processes related to conservation of air, soil and water. They work with Government, NGOs as well as multinationals engaged in this act.
Environmental Engineering Syllabus at the Undergraduate level
The syllabus of Environmental Engineering has been structured to provide in-depth knowledge into the subject along with practical training. Environmental engineering has been considered as a sub-division of Chemical Engineering and Civil Engineering. So the students have to study sections of Civil and Chemical engineering too. Besides, they have to study the principles of Biology, Microbiology, Physics and Organic Chemistry that deals with the theory of biodiversity, climate change, conservation of soil, ground water etc. Here we have attempted to provide a detailed idea about the syllabus in the form of a table:
| Semester 1& 2 | Semester 3 |
|---|---|
| Engineering Maths 1 &2 | Engineering Mathematics 3 |
| Engineering Physics | Environmental Chemistry1 |
| Elements of Civil Engineering and Engineering Mechanics | Strength of Materials |
| Elements of Mechanical Engineering | Surveying 1 |
| Basic Electrical Engineering | Fluid Mechanics |
| Workshop Practice | Environmental Biology |
| Engineering Physics Lab | Environmental Analysis Laboratory 1 |
| Constitution Of India and Professional Ethics | Surveying Practice 1 |
| Semester 4 | Semester 5 |
| Engineering Mathematics 4 | Municipal Solid Waste Management |
| Surveying Construction | Origin and Characterization of Environmental Pollution |
| Environmental Chemistry 2 | Water Supply and Distribution System |
| Elements of Environmental Protection | Geotechnical Engineering 1 |
| Hydraulics and Hydraulic Machines | Hydrology and water Resources Engineering |
| Applied Engineering Geology | Water Treatment Engineering |
| Environmental Analysis Laboratory 2 | Design and Drawing of Environmental System 1 |
| Fluid and Hydraulic Machinery Lab | Environmental Process Laboratory 1 |
| Semester 6 | Semester 7 |
| Management and Entrepreneurship | Computer Application in Environmental Engineering |
| Environmental Transport Processes | Ecology and Environmental Impact Assessment |
| Atmospheric Environmental Engineering | Advanced Waste Water Treatment |
| Waste Water Collection and Drainage System | Estimation, Specification and Financial Aspects of Environmental Facilities |
| Wastewater Treatment Engineering | Elective 2 Group B ( Nuclear, Radioactive and Bio-medical Waste Technology, Occupational Safety and Health, Operation and Maintenance of Environmental Facilities) |
| Elective 1 Group A ( Environmental Biotechnology, Eco-friendly Energy Sources, Environmental System Optimization) | Elective 3 Group C (environmental Aspects of Development Projects, Environmental Applications of Remote Sensing and GIS, Geo Environmental Engineering) |
| Atmospheric Environmental Lab | Design and Drawing of Environmental system II |
| Environmental Process Lab 2 | Computer Application Lab |

Work Description
- Supervise the design of systems, processes, or equipments for control, management, or remediation of water, air, or soil quality.
- Collaborate with environmental scientists, planners, hazardous waste technicians, engineers, or other specialists to address environmental problems.
- Provide technical support for environmental remediation of projects, including remediation system designing or determination of regulatory applicability.
- Prepare hazardous waste manifests or land disposal restriction notifications.
- Assess the existing or potential environmental impact of projects on air, water, or land.
- Prepare, maintain, or revise quality assurance documentation or procedures.
- Assist in budget implementation, forecasts, or administration.
- Provide environmental engineering assistance in network analysis, regulatory analysis, or planning or reviewing database development.

Frequently Asked Questions (FAQs) Environmental Engineering
Question: What is the scope of Environmental Engineering Course in India?
Answer :
The scope of the Environmental Engineering Course in India is immense, but as the filed iv very vast, one should be specific about the domain. Students opting for wastewater treatment or hazardous waste management will find ample opportunities in both government and private sectors. Students specialised in conservation, and sustainable resource consumption as their field is one of the highest-paid and recruited professionals, and their job is not only limited to desk work, but they are provided with the opportunity to conduct and give speeches in conferences
Aspirants who wish to learn and leave a positive impact by their work can also get a job in various NGOs which are of national and international level as they often look for environmental engineers to aid public health problems.
Question: Is it possible for a mechanical engineer to become an environmental engineer? If so, how?
Answer :
Shifting to Environmental Engineering from mechanical Engineering is possible. As a Bachelor’s degree in mechanical engineering also qualifies under environmental engineering, students can opt for a post graduation course after clearing the eligibility criteria of the institute. Plus, it is not at all a downfall as the Environmental Engineering field is at a rise, the job packages and profiles offered are good.
